The Visual Artist’s Collective (VAC), an art organization based in Henry County, held their annual Christmas With the Arts event. The event, which involves the Henry Arts Alliance and Henry Players, features some of the best creative talents in the County.
The VAC portion is the year-end art contest, where prizes are awarded in two categories. Additionally, ticket holders vote for Best of Show. Morrison’s piece entitled “Southern Exposure” took first place in the photography category as well as being awarded Best of Show by those attending the event.
“Southern Exposure,” said Morrison “is an HDR shot, where three different exposures were merged to create the final image. It was taken off Highway 20 toward Hampton. Just for scale, you can see a cow near the base of the tree in the center.”
